My lessons are interactive, practical, and adapted to each student's learning pace and goals. I believe that the best way to learn programming is by actively building projects and solving real problems rather than only studying theory.
I have experience teaching Python, HTML, CSS, JavaScript, React, and computational thinking to students of different ages and skill levels. As a Programming Train...
My lessons are interactive, practical, and adapted to each student's learning pace and goals. I believe that the best way to learn programming is by actively building projects and solving real problems rather than only studying theory.
I have experience teaching Python, HTML, CSS, JavaScript, React, and computational thinking to students of different ages and skill levels. As a Programming Trainer and former Python Mentor, I have worked with both beginners and students who already have some coding experience. This has helped me develop flexible teaching methods that suit different learning styles.
A typical lesson includes a brief introduction to new concepts, guided exercises, hands-on coding practice, and feedback on completed tasks. I explain technical topics using simple language, visual examples, real-life analogies, and step-by-step demonstrations to make complex concepts easier to understand.
Students will learn not only how to write code but also how to think like programmers. We focus on problem-solving, debugging techniques, project planning, and developing logical thinking skills. Depending on your interests, we can create websites, interactive applications, Python programs, or work on school and university assignments.
I encourage questions, curiosity, and active participation throughout every lesson. My goal is to create a supportive, motivating, and enjoyable learning environment where students build confidence, gain practical skills, and become independent learners who can continue growing beyond our lessons.
Mehr anzeigen
Weniger anzeigen